What is CAR T-Cell Therapy?

CAR T-cell therapy is a new way to treat acute lymphoblastic leukemia. This cancer treatment uses the body’s own cells to fight cancer. Doctors take blood from the patient and change some of the cells in a lab. These changed cells are then put back into the patient’s body. They aim to find and kill cancer cells more effectively.

The process starts with taking T-cells from the patient’s blood. These T-cells are important parts of our immune system that help fight diseases including cancers like ac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L). In a lab scientists add special receptors called CARs to these T-cells. The modified T-cells can now better recognize and attack leukemia cells when they return to the patient’s bloodstream.

Patients usually receive their modified CAR T-cells through an IV infusion. This step allows the new stronger T-cells to enter their bodies directly. Once inside these enhanced cells start working right away to find and destroy cancerous ones. Many patients see good results from this type of ALL treatment.

Benefits Of CAR T-Cell Therapy

CAR T-cell therapy offers many benefits for treating acute lymphoblastic leukemia. One major advantage is its ability to target cancer cells specifically. This precision reduces damage to healthy cells which often occurs in traditional treatments. Patients can experience fewer side effects because of this targeted approach. Many find that their quality of life improves during and after the treatment.

Another benefit is the lasting impact on cancer cells in the body. CAR T-cell therapy trains your immune system to recognize and attack leukemia cells even after treatment ends. This ongoing vigilance helps prevent relapse which is a common issue with other ALL treatments. Patients often feel more confident knowing their bodies continue fighting against cancer long-term.

The effectiveness of CAR T-cell therapy also stands out among newer cancer treatments. Clinical trials have shown promising results especially for patients who did not respond well to other therapies before trying this one. The high success rate makes it an appealing option for many facing tough battles with acute lymphoblastic leukemia.

Side Effects To Consider

When starting CAR T-cell therapy patients should be aware of possible side effects. One common issue is cytokine release syndrome (CRS) which can cause fever and chills. CRS happens when the immune system responds strongly to the new cells. While this shows that the treatment is working it can make patients feel unwell for a while.

Neurological problems are another side effect some patients may experience during CAR T-cell therapy. These issues can include headaches, confusion, or even trouble speaking. Although these symptoms often go away on their own they can be worrying at first. It’s important for patients and families to know what signs to look out for and report them quickly.

Fatigue is also a frequent side effect of leukemia therapy treatments like CAR T-cell therapy. Patients might feel more tired than usual during their ALL treatment period. This fatigue can affect daily activities but usually improves over time as the body adjusts to the new cells fighting cancerous ones inside it effectively.
